oil-bath or drip lubrication for continuous high-speed operation\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n      \u003c\/tbody\u003e\n    \u003c\/table\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003e❓ Frequently Asked Questions\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eHow do I choose between a simplex (-1) and duplex (-2) chain?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eSimplex (single-row) chains are suitable for standard power transmission where the drive sprocket and driven sprocket are aligned on a single plane. Duplex (double-row) chains carry approximately twice the working load of the equivalent simplex chain within the same pitch, making them the right choice when torque demands are high but space constraints prevent moving to a larger pitch. If your existing drive uses a duplex sprocket, you must select a duplex chain.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eWhat pitch do I need — how do I identify my current chain?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eMeasure the distance between the centers of three consecutive pins and divide by two — that is your pitch. Common pitches in this listing: 04C = 6.35 mm, 05B = 8 mm, 06B\/06C = 9.525 mm, 08A\/08B = 12.7 mm, 10A\/10B = 15.875 mm, 12A\/12B = 19.05 mm, 16A\/16B = 25.4 mm. You can also read the chain model number stamped on the outer plate.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eWill this chain fit my existing sprocket?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eYes, provided your sprocket is manufactured to ISO 606 (B-series) or ANSI B29.1 (A-series) tolerances and the model designation matches. For example, a 08B-1 chain fits an 08B sprocket. Always verify the sprocket's pitch, roller diameter clearance, and tooth profile before installing a replacement chain.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eHow strong is this roller chain — what is the tensile strength?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eTensile strength varies by model. As a general reference, ISO 606 specifies minimum breaking loads ranging from approximately 3.5 kN for 04C up to 170 kN for 16B duplex. For safety-critical applications, always apply an appropriate service factor (typically 7–10×) when calculating working load.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eIs this chain suitable for outdoor or wet environments?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e factory oil coating provides short-term protection against oxidation during storage and initial use in sheltered environments. For continuous outdoor, wet, or chemically aggressive environments, we recommend applying a chain-specific lubricant or corrosion inhibitor after installation and at regular maintenance intervals. For highly corrosive conditions, consider stainless steel chain variants.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eCan I cut this chain to a shorter length?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eYes. The 1.524 m strand can be shortened to any number of links using a chain breaker tool. After cutting, rejoin the ends with a standard connecting link (spring-clip or cotter-pin type) of the matching chain model. Ensure the final loop length matches your center-distance and tensioner range.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n    \u003cdetails\u003e\n      \u003csummary\u003eHow do I lubricate and maintain this roller chain?\u003c\/summary\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-faq-body\"\u003e\u003cp\u003eFor low-speed or intermittent drives, manual lubrication with a brush or oil can applied to the inner plates every 8–40 hours of operation is sufficient. For continuous or high-speed drives, a drip oiler or oil-bath system is recommended. Use a SAE 30–40 non-detergent mineral oil or a dedicated chain lubricant. Avoid over-lubrication, which attracts abrasive particles and accelerates wear.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/details\u003e\n\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"hdiy-cta\"\u003e\n    🛒 Select your Chain Model and Chain Length above, then add to cart.\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\n\u003cscript type=\"application\/ld+json\"\u003e\n{\n  \"@context\": \"https:\/\/schema.org\",\n  \"@type\": \"FAQPage\",\n  \"mainEntity\": [\n    {\n      \"@type\": \"Question\",\n      \"name\": \"How do I choose between a simplex (-1) and duplex (-2) chain?\",\n      \"acceptedAnswer\": {\n        \"@type\": \"Answer\",\n        \"text\": \"Simplex (single-row) chains are suitable for standard power transmission where the drive sprocket and driven sprocket are aligned on a single plane.
